Dermatomes Upper Limb
Dermatomes: A dermatome is an area of skin which is chiefly supplied by a single spinal nerve. There are 8 cervical nerves (C1 denoting an anomaly with no dermatome), 12 thoracic nerves(T1-T12), 5 lumbar nerves(L1-L5) and 5 sacral nerves(S1-S5).
